I am having problems setting up NAT for my home LAN.

I get the following:

frigorifero root # iptables -v -t nat -A POSTROUTING -o ppp0 -j MASQUERADE
MASQUERADE  all opt -- in * out ppp0  0.0.0.0/0  -> 0.0.0.0/0
iptables: Invalid argument

and iptables says:

frigorifero root # iptables -h
iptables v1.2.7a

My PPP link is a DSL line, I use rp-pppoe and I up it using adsl-start.
All modules for iptables load fine. I also tried the iptables commantd 
with eth1 as a parameter. Same result. Haven't been able to find any 
answer anywhere in the docs or list archives so please...heeeelp.

Can anyone tell me what am I doing wrong?
